Histórico de mensagens sobre certificado em bolix

EXIBINDO CONVERSAS RECENTES:

Texto: certificado
Canal: bolix
Avatar discord do usuario tingu1903

tingu1903

Ver Respostas

Boa tarde @guilherme_efi , obrigado pela rápida atenção.
Gerei um certificado no modo Homologação, pois já tinha criado em Produção.
Ativei no WP e a mensagem que apareceu agora e diferente: Forbidden

Que será que eu errei?

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Boa tarde, @tingu1903. Como vai?
Esta falha ocorre quando não encontra o certificado da API Pix em seu site.
Segue um passo a passo de como gerar este certificado em sua conta: https://gerencianet.com.br/artigo/como-gerar-o-certificado-para-usar-a-api-pix/#versao-7

Após gerá-lo, você deve selecionar ele nas configurações do módulo.
Em nossa documentação você encontra mais detalhes: https://dev.gerencianet.com.br/docs/wordpress-woocommerce#3-configura%C3%A7%C3%B5es-do-plugin-gerencianet-para-woocommerce
imagem enviada na mensagem pelo usuario guilherme_efi

Avatar discord do usuario victor.cardinali

victor.cardinali

Ver Respostas

Boa noite pessoal, tudo bem?
Gostaria de saber se para gerar BOLIX também é necessário Certificado mTLS?

Avatar discord do usuario andresisdanca

andresisdanca

Ver Respostas

Os parametros são estes aqui para pegar o token?

String basicAuth = Base64.getEncoder().encodeToString(((this.clienteId + ':' + this.clienteSecret).getBytes()));

HttpPost httpPost = new HttpPost(rota);
httpPost.setHeader("Content-Type", "application/json");
httpPost.setHeader("Authorization", "Basic " + basicAuth);
String requestJson = "{"grant_type": "client_credentials"}";

Retirei o certificado e estou na rota https://sandbox.gerencianet.com.br/v1/authorize

E continua dando não autorizado.

Esta API de vcs não tive muito sucesso com ela ... desculpe.

Será que estou com o Bolix liberado para realizar as transações?
O Cliente Id e o ClienteSecret é o mesmo do PIX?

Avatar discord do usuario joao_efi

joao_efi

Ver Respostas

<@!883000147938783272> O processo é diferente! Para a emissão do pix é necessário a utilização do certificado gerado na sua conta Gerencianet, já no bolix não precisa do certificado.
Além disso as URLs para requisições são diferentes, sendo:

No nosso Github você encontra nossas SDKs, que podem facilitar essa parte do desenvolvimento!
https://github.com/gerencianet

Avatar discord do usuario carlosh.skraba4582

carlosh.skraba4582

mas não há um Creator sem o certificado, apenas se eu utilizar um dynamic..

Avatar discord do usuario jessica_efi

jessica_efi

Por exemplo, para gerar o boleto você esta passando o certificado e não é necessário. O certificado so é necessário para consumos do pix.

Avatar discord do usuario carlosh.skraba4582

carlosh.skraba4582

bolix está ativada.. metadata do SDK, com certificado entre os parametros.
imagem enviada na mensagem pelo usuario carlosh.skraba4582

Avatar discord do usuario jessica_efi

jessica_efi

Bom dia <@!885922631784734760> ! Pra você gerar o bolix, você não precisa do certificado. Você vai gerar uma cobrança de boleto normal, e a opção bolix deve estar ativada em sua conta Gerencianet.

Avatar discord do usuario carlosh.skraba4582

carlosh.skraba4582

pessoal, bom dia.. preciso de ajuda: uso o SDK .NET, as percebi que a assinatura da instanciação do Endpoint difere do modelo do manual.. falta no manual o certificado.. enfim, não deve ter relação com o problema, mas foi a única diferença do meu código com o que está no manual, mas estou obtendo este erro: "Unexpected character encountered while parsing value: U. Path '', line 0, position 0."

Avatar discord do usuario jessica_efi

jessica_efi

Bom dia <@!697886743239852185> ! No arquivo credentials.json(Gerencianet.NETCore.SDK.Examples/credentials.json) você passa o caminho do certificado.

Avatar discord do usuario holerite.

holerite.

Bom dia.
Estou tentando utilizar os exemplos da Gerencianet.NETCore.SDK.Examples, como faço para passar o certificado p.12 para a geração dos endpoints

Avatar discord do usuario luizgerencianet

luizgerencianet

E sim, este certificado é necessário para gerar o Bolix

Avatar discord do usuario luizgerencianet

luizgerencianet

Assim que você cria um certificado, é possível realizar o download do mesmo (Aparece um modal na tela)

Avatar discord do usuario maxivane_

maxivane_

Ah sim legal vou testar isso hoje na hora do almoço..
Só mais umas perguntas antes de finalizar rsrsrs:
Pra utilizar o Bolix preciso de um certificado né.. lá na minha conta eu criei um, mas onde baixa?

Avatar discord do usuario matheus_efi

matheus_efi

Bom dia, <@!572575366112083968>. Não sei como está configurado a sua SDK mas isso pode estar relacionado ao fato que as requisições para Pix e boletos diferem na autenticação e consumo dos endpoints, pois, na API de boletos você não envia o certificado. Recomendo olhar a SDK em JAVA(https://github.com/gerencianet/gn-api-sdk-java) que disponibilizamos para entender melhor como está sendo feito esse fluxo. Em especial nesta parte https://github.com/gerencianet/gn-api-sdk-java/tree/master/src/main/java/br/com/gerencianet/gnsdk

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Olá, <@!804392227173302333>. Bom dia!
Siga os passos, e vaja se irá solucionar sua demanda:

Abra o arquivo de configuração do PHP php.ini. A a localização deste arquivo pode variar de como seu PHP foi instalado. Ex: etc\php\php7.4, versão do seu PHP e faça a alteração a seguir:
- Procure pela linha: curl.cainfo =
- Então, ou você comenta esta linha com ;, ficando assim: ;curl.cainfo =
- Ou então, informe o caminho correto para seu certificado. Assim: curl.cainfo = "\caminho\onde\voce\salvou\seu\certificado\cacert.pem"

Avatar discord do usuario guilherme_efi

guilherme_efi

<@!824767143933509722> Esta falha curl 60 pode estar relacionada ao cURL configurado em seu servidor.

Sei te dizer que no PHP, possui uma configuração que define um certificado.
Para corrigir, bastaria acessar o php.ini buscar pelo trecho curl.cainfo = e comentá-lo inserindo o ;

Avatar discord do usuario guilherme_efi

guilherme_efi

Ver Respostas

Boa tarde, <@!824767143933509722>! Como vai?
No caso, para a requisição de geração de boleto, não é necessário um certificado.

Avatar discord do usuario christianosilveira4948

christianosilveira4948

Ver Respostas

Boa tarde.

Estou fazendo testes para integração mas esta me apresentando error curl 60, vi que é um erro relacionado com certificado não encontrado, baixei o certificado, mas não achei como valida-lo com cURL.